Things to do in Landrum?
Living in Landrum, SC is an enjoyable experience. The small town atmosphere provides a comfortable, safe environment that makes it easy to meet and get to know your neighbors. It is also conveniently located close to larger cities such as Greenville and Spartanburg, making it easy to access modern conveniences while still maintaining the feeling of living in a rural community. There are plenty of outdoor activities available such as camping, fishing, boating, and hiking at nearby lakes and parks. The area also has several local attractions such as historic sites and museums for residents to explore for entertainment or educational opportunities. Additionally, the cost of living is generally lower than average which makes it a great place for families or individuals looking for an affordable lifestyle without sacrificing amenities.
